Solana Sees Surge in Positive Sentiment Amid Apple Partnership Rumors
Solana is gaining significant attention in the cryptocurrency market as positive sentiment surrounding the digital asset has surged, reinforcing its status as a prominent player in the industry.
Recent data from leading on-chain analytics firm Santiment indicates a notable rise in optimism toward Solana, driven by renewed investor confidence and a series of encouraging developments within its ecosystem. The firm shared these insights on X, sparking discussions about the potential implications for the digital asset.
The increase in enthusiasm among SOL investors and traders has reached a nine-month high, with approximately 5.6 positive posts for every negative one across major social media platforms, including X, Reddit, and Telegram. Santiment first detected this shift in market sentiment last Friday, highlighting that while many cryptocurrencies experienced gains, Solana notably stood out with a substantial rise in bullish sentiment.
A key factor contributing to this optimism is speculation that Apple may be considering utilizing the Solana blockchain, generating significant hype around the asset. In contrast, the sentiment surrounding other major c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in ( BTC ) and Ethereum ( ETH ), has remained relatively stable, suggesting a more bullish outlook for Solana in the short term.

Traders and investors are encouraged to monitor SOL’s price closely, given the influence of social media hype on cryptocurrency valuations.
In response to the speculation regarding Apple’s potential involvement, SOL’s price has shown bullish trends, with a nearly 4% increase, pushing it above the $150 mark. As of now, SOL is trading at approximately $153, reflecting a 3.45% rise in market cap and an 80.10% surge in trading volume over the past day. Should these rumors be officially confirmed, it’s likely that Solana will see further price gains in the near future.
